Action line - 80302 Wing runs Published March 24, 2008 By Anonymous 39th Air Base Wing Public Affairs INCIRLIK AIR BASE, Turkey -- Complaint: I have a suggestion for the wing formation run that we have at the end of each month. I am a huge fan of running and an even bigger fan of camaraderie so I enjoy the wing formation runs but, because everyone has a different speed, it actually hurts to run because of the speed changing constantly. I would like to propose a change to the formation line up. Currently we run in our individual squadrons, what if we promote cohesion of the wing by building the formations to coincide with the speeds that each Airman can run? I believe we would have less fall outs and we can bring the members of this wing even closer together. Thank you for your consideration. Response: I am glad that you enjoy the wing formation runs and agree they are a great way to build camaraderie. In fact, I view the wing runs as much more of a camaraderie/team-building event than PT, which is why we structure the formation as we do. The squadron remains the basic building block of our expeditionary force and as such I feel it important to build up the squadron as often as possible. Organizing by squadron during wing runs allows us to do that. As for the pace, we shoot for a pace that accommodates most of the folks in the wing. While some find the pace too slow, as many others find it too fast ... I think we've found a happy medium from some of the feedback we have received. Please encourage your squadron mates during our wing runs; with your support I hope fewer and fewer will fall out of formation in the future.
